Let's take a minute to talk about your medication. This is Focalin. You may hear it called by its generic name, dexmethylphenidate. This medicine helps to treat attention deficit hyperactivity disorder, or ADHD. Focalin is a stimulant medicine, but it calms people with ADHD so they can focus, work, and learn.  Focalin is available in different forms. You were prescribed the extended release capsule. It is often given one time each day, in the morning. You should take it exactly as prescribed by the doctor. You can take the dose with or without food. However, it may take longer to start working if you give it with food. Be sure to swallow the capsules whole. Never chew or crush them. Most people tolerate this medication well and it is considered safe when taken under a doctor's care. Still, you should wait until you know how Focalin affects you before doing things like driving a car or anything that requires attention. Common side effects can happen, like stomach upset, headaches, or loss of appetite. Others include irritability or problems sleeping. These are normal if they are mild and should go away. If these or other side effects become reasons you want to stop taking this medicine, please talk to your doctor or pharmacist. As with any medicine, rare but serious side effects could occur. You should read the Medication Guide to know which symptoms to watch for and when to report changes. Always call the doctor right away if you notice any unusual changes to your body, and any troublesome moods, thoughts or behaviors. Focalin can interact with other medications. You should tell your doctor about any medicines you take and check with your doctor or pharmacist before taking other medicines. This medicine is controlled by federal law. It has a risk for addiction, abuse, misuse, overdose, and death. It can be dangerous to others, so store it in a safe place. After you stop taking it you should dispose of it properly.  Ask your pharmacist about proper disposal options in your area or go to the FDA.gov website for more information. For best results with Focalin, take it exactly as prescribed and follow your doctor's orders for counseling and other therapies.
